Anna Chupa received her Master of Fine Arts degree at the University of Delaware and a Master of Arts in Liberal Studies
at Dartmouth College. Her primary artistic disciplines prior to working in digital media were painting, textiles, printmaking,
and performance art. She has published a book and several essays on Jungian archetypes in African-American fiction. Her
digital photography and mixed media installations have been exhibited at SIGGRAPH, the Digital Salon, and the Silicon Gallery
in Philadelphia.
